Appropriations and Budget 

The House Appropriations Committee introduced HR 1105 on February 23 2009, an omnibus appropriations bill for FY 09. The continuing resolution (CR) that is currently funding the government will expire on March 6, 2009.

The chart below shows how NACAC recommendations for FY 2009 compare with appropriations from the previous years, and Congressional action to date (HR 1105). Those marked with a star (*) were developed in concert with the Student Aid Alliance

Funds for the Pell Grant maximum and Work Study in the "FY 09 Congress" column reflect funds approved for those programs under HR 1, The American Recovery and Reinvestment Act. Visit NACAC's page on the economic stimulus for more information on that legislation.

Program FY 07 Final FY 08 Final FY 09 NACAC FY 09 Congress

Pell Grant max

$4,310

$4,731

$5,100* $5,350
SEOG $771 m $757 m $1 b* $757 m
Work Study $980 m $980.4 m $1.25 b* $1.18 b
LEAP $64 m $64 m $100 m* $64 m
GEAR UP $303 m $303 m $350 m* $313 m
TRIO $828 m $828 m $948* $848 m
ESSCP $35 m $48.6 m $75 m $52 m
